a4163ba222 Chop/mine designation gate + reachability gates on Doctor & Eat
Player reported pawns ignoring chop designations. Root cause:
ChopProvider/MineProvider iterated World.trees/World.rocks
unconditionally — paint set a null sentinel and never touched the entity,
so designation was cosmetic only. Pawns auto-chopped nearest unfelled tree.

* Added chop_designated: bool to Tree, mine_designated: bool to Rock and
  BigRock (footprint-aware: paint on any of the 4 footprint cells flags
  the boulder). Save/load round-trips the flag.

* world.gd._on_designation_added 'chop'/'mine' cases now find the entity
  at the painted tile and flip the flag. _on_designation_cleared inverts.

* Boot seed auto-designates SAMPLE_TREES / SAMPLE_ROCKS / SAMPLE_BIG_ROCKS
  so the cabin demo still produces wood + stone end-to-end without
  requiring the player to paint first.

Also from the same audit (researcher mapped all 11 WorkProviders):

* DoctorProvider + EatProvider now pre-check reachability with
  pathfinder.find_path before issuing a job, mirroring HaulingProvider's
  pattern. Previously they handed out doomed walks that JobRunner had to
  cancel, busy-spinning at 20 Hz.

Verified end-to-end via MCP runtime: undesignated tree/rock returns null
from provider; paint flips the flag and provider returns a chop/mine job;
un-paint clears the flag; BigRock footprint paint works on any of the 4
cells.

938e871bf1 Add BigRock: 2×2 mineable boulder with full mining/path/save support
A new entity for multi-tile rock formations. Same duck-typed contract as
single-tile Rock so MineProvider scans both transparently via World.rocks.

Differences from Rock:
  • Occupies a 2×2 footprint anchored at origin_tile (top-left).
  • Renders a single 32×32 Sprite2D drawn from the FG_Grasslands_Spring 2×2
    cluster sprites at (22, 3) brown and (30, 3) gray.
  • Blocks pathfinding on all four footprint tiles — pawns route around it.
  • MineProvider asks `rock.approach_tile_for(pawn.tile)` for the walk
    destination, so the pawn stands beside the boulder instead of trying to
    path into the blocked footprint. Rock returns its own tile (walkable);
    BigRock picks the nearest walkable perimeter neighbour.
  • Mining takes 480 ticks (4× Rock) and drops 4 stone, one per footprint tile.

All init work happens in setup() rather than _ready(): the calling pattern is
`add_child(big); big.setup(origin)`, and _ready fires inside add_child with
origin_tile still at its zero default — anything reading origin_tile from
_ready would stamp the pathfinder at the wrong tile.

Wired through SaveSystem: factory preload, spawn-priority tier 0 (same as
Rock — static structures spawn before pawns), and a `&"big_rock"` factory.

World seed adds two demo boulders near the small-rock cluster
(65, 58) + (56, 64) so the visual contrast is on-screen from boot.
